The following information is for Companies M and N for the most recent year:  Company M  Company N  Sales $500,000$500,000 Variable costs $300,000$200,000 Fixed costs $50,000$150,000\begin{array} { | l | c | c | } \hline & \text { Company M } & \text { Company N } \\\hline \text { Sales } & \$ 500,000 & \$ 500,000 \\\hline \text { Variable costs } & \$ 300,000 & \$ 200,000 \\\hline \text { Fixed costs } & \$ 50,000 & \$ 150,000 \\\hline\end{array} Based on this information, select the incorrect statement:


A) M's magnitude of operating leverage was lower than N's.
B) N would suffer more than M from an equal drop in sales revenue.
C) M's cost structure carries greater risk and greater potential for profit.
D) If N's sales increased by 20%, its net income would increase by 40%.
